What is the difference between Commission Deltav Dcs Engineer vs Control Systems Engineer?

AspectCommission Deltav Dcs EngineerControl Systems Engineer
CertificationsDeltaV certification, control system certificationsControl system certifications, PLC programming certifications
Work EnvironmentField commissioning, system testing, startup phasesDesign, development, and integration of control systems
Industry UsageOil & gas, chemical, manufacturing plantsManufacturing, automation, process industries

The Commission Deltav Dcs Engineer primarily focuses on the installation, testing, and commissioning of DeltaV control systems on-site, ensuring operational readiness. In contrast, the Control Systems Engineer is involved in designing, developing, and integrating control systems, often working in design offices or labs. Both roles require control system knowledge and certifications but differ mainly in their focus on field commissioning versus system design.

What are some common challenges faced by Commission DeltaV DCS Engineers during system commissioning, and how can they be addressed?

Commission DeltaV DCS Engineers often encounter challenges such as integrating new hardware with legacy systems, troubleshooting unexpected control logic issues, and coordinating with multidisciplinary teams under tight project timelines. Effective communication with process engineers and electricians, thorough documentation, and advance simulation/testing of control strategies can help mitigate these challenges. Additionally, staying updated with the latest DeltaV software updates and Emerson best practices enables smoother commissioning and reduces downtime during startup.

What is a Commission DeltaV DCS Engineer?

A Commission DeltaV DCS Engineer is a specialist responsible for configuring, testing, and commissioning Emerson's DeltaV Distributed Control System (DCS) in industrial settings. They play a key role in ensuring that automation systems operate safely and efficiently by installing hardware, writing control logic, and integrating the system with other plant equipment. These engineers also troubleshoot issues, optimize system performance, and often provide training and support to plant personnel. Their work is critical during the startup phase of new plants or during major upgrades to existing facilities.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Commission DeltaV DCS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Commission DeltaV DCS Engineer, you need a solid background in process automation, control systems engineering, and a degree in electrical, chemical, or automation engineering. Expertise in Emerson DeltaV Distributed Control Systems, PLC programming, and relevant industry certifications like Emerson DeltaV certifications are typically required. Strong problem-solving abilities, attention to detail, and effective communication are vital soft skills for collaborating with multidisciplinary teams and troubleshooting complex systems. These skills ensure reliable system commissioning, optimal plant performance, and successful project delivery in industrial automation environments.

Job Title: Automation SME (DCS/DeltaV)

Location: Maryland (Onsite)
Industry: Pharmaceutical / Biopharmaceutical
Experience: 8+ Years

Job Description:

We are seeking an experienced Automation SME with strong expertise in DeltaV DCS to support automation projects in a GMP-regulated pharmaceutical manufacturing environment. The ideal candidate will provide technical leadership for system design, configuration, commissioning, troubleshooting, and lifecycle support of process automation systems.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Configure, maintain, and troubleshoot Emerson DeltaV DCS systems.
  • Support automation projects including system upgrades, commissioning, FAT/SAT, and startup activities.
  • Develop and review control strategies, HMI graphics, alarms, and system documentation.
  • Support change controls, deviations, CAPAs, and Computer System Validation (CSV) activities.
  • Collaborate with Manufacturing, Engineering, Validation, and Quality teams to ensure GMP compliance.
  • Provide technical support for process optimization and automation system reliability.

Requirements:

  • Bachelor's degree in Engineering or related field.
  • 8+ years of automation experience in the pharmaceutical or biotech industry.
  • Strong hands-on experience with Emerson DeltaV DCS.
  • Experience with PLC/SCADA, GMP, GAMP5, and 21 CFR Part 11.
  • Knowledge of commissioning, qualification (CQV), FAT/SAT, and validation activities.
  • Excellent troubleshooting and cross-functional communication skills.
